Audiences were welcomed back to the iconic London County Hall last night as Agatha Christie’s Witness for the Prosecution reopened with a brand-new cast following a 78 week closure due to the pandemic. The acclaimed production opened its doors in time to celebrate what would have been Agatha Christie’s 131st birthday today, Wednesday 15 September.
Joe McNamara makes his professional stage debut as the accused, Leonard Vole. He will be joined by Emer McDaid as Romaine, Jonathan Firth as Sir Wilfrid Robarts, Teddy Kempner as Mr Mayhew, Miles Richardson as Mr Myers and Martin Turner as Mr Justice Wainwright.
